Packing for Mars

by Mary Roach
318 pages

I love Mary Roach's previous witty non-fiction books and had to read this. And what timing, too! I started it right as NASA was having its final hurrah with the launch of space shuttle Atlantis. Packing for Mars is an in-depth look at traveling to/in space from the space race to 2010. Roach discusses the test flights, food studies, bathroom issues and even sex in space. Though she spent a tremendous amount of pages on the perils of pooping in space, I thought it was a great read and I normally don't like non-fiction.
